GLM-OCR is a tiny (0.9B parameter) multimodal OCR model built on the GLM-V encoder-decoder architecture. Despite its small size, it ranks #1 on OmniDocBench V1.5 (94.62 overall score), outperforming models 10x its size on complex document understanding tasks including tables, formulas, handwriting, and multi-column layouts.
Its MIT license and sub-1B parameter count make it ideal for edge deployment, serverless functions, and cost-sensitive pipelines. On Mixpeek, GLM-OCR powers document text extraction for PDFs, scanned images, and screenshots where high accuracy matters more than raw throughput.
Architecture
GLM-V encoder-decoder with vision encoder (ViT variant) and autoregressive text decoder. 0.9B total parameters. Processes document images at native resolution with adaptive tiling for multi-page documents.
